01. Proof of Consent
What isÌýthis?ÌýConsent is an active andÌýexplicitÌýÌýuserÌýprocess that must be free, specific, and informed. In an online form, it can materialize, for example, by a checkbox, unchecked by default.

03. Pseudonymization
What is this?ÌýPseudonymization helps telling apartÌýpersonal dataÌýfrom other irrelevant information. Pseudonymization generates an identification key that allows to establish the link between variousÌýpersonalÌýinformation sources.

04. Data Portability
What isÌýthis? Users have the right to claim all the personal data they have provided to a service, in a structured format, preferably userÌýmachine-readable. They also have the right to transmit this data to another processing manage.

05. Privacy by designÌý
What isÌýthis? Data protection requirements must be taken into account by organizations as early as since the design stage of their products, services and systems.

06. AccountabilityÌý
What isÌýthis ? Accountability is the obligation made for companies to implement appropriate technical and organizational measures to ensure that the treatment of personal data is performed under the Regulation, and be able to demonstrate.
